Just loaded it. No issues so far. Restart Installs an ME update to 11.8.55.3510.

Possibly UEFI selection terminology has changed a bit (Now CSM to auto, select windows boot manager then at reboot it renames to windows UEFI) but I could be remembering another system I did more recently. 1 further uncalled for POST-restart during the next boot and now seems fine

I have updated from 0605 to 1412 and almost instantly regret. Issues:

  • Every enter to bios end with increase this samsung 970 evo smart parameter: "Error Information Log Entries:" regardless with or without saving changes
  • If I remember right with 0605 fans instantly start with qfan profile loaded = silent. Now they start from upper level and after while slow down to defined threshold


What does this bios do to samsung ssd causing errors in log ?
